This writer doesn't presume to have all the answers—let's make that perfectly clear right from the beginning. However, in looking back over some eight decades now, all the while prayerfully wrestling with my own personal "holiness dilemma," a number of illuminations have surfaced and settled in my thinking. I use the word "illuminations," as opposed to "revelation" and "inspiration" because I'm not totally clear on the source, often vacillating between the human and divine. I can say, without reservation, that it has been a sincere and honest quest for Truth and that has kept the substance of these mini e-books  (3 in 1) evolving. During this lengthy pilgrimage, it has surprised me to find so many others along the way wrestling with the same "dilemma." And you, dear reader, may be among them. This emerging generation is now joining in on the chorus. Thus, I feel Spirit-led to share the results of this quest, to date, in a mini-series of simple personal holiness illuminations. My hope and prayer is that the reader will also be illuminated likewise.
